Lessons Learned - Galileo Photopolarimeter Radiometer (PPR) Cover Damage During Assembly and Test

Abstract:

The Galileo Photopolarimeter Radiometer subsystem cover was damaged on three separate occasions during assembly and test operations. Design all external areas of spacecraft flight hardware with consideration for assembly and handling operations: avoid sharp or pointed corners. Conduct physical surveys to identify hardware that is susceptible to handling damage.
